>> >> I was trying to find out how to create a new version of an item as the
>> >> administrator of the repository but I couldn't find it!
>> >>
>> >> Is this true or am I too stubborn to find it?
>> >
>> > (On trunk version) I see "New version" under the 'Actions' for an eprint
>> > owned by a user when I'm logged in as an admin?
>> >
>> > What do you see under the eprint's actions tab?
>
>> There is no "Actions" Tab when I am logged in as administrator!
>>
>> The steps I am performing are the following:
>>
>> 1)Logging in as administrator
>> 2)Manage records
>> 3)Select one (View) that has been deposited by a normal user
>> 4)Then I get only "Edit" and "Destroy" as tabs and below are the
>> options "Details" and "Export"
>>
>> On the other hand when logged in as the user that has deposited the
>> eprint when I try "View" I get the following 4 tabs : "Preview",
>> "Details", "Actions", "History". But these are NOT visible as the
>> Administrator!
>
> Ah, I'm afraid "Manage records" is a confusion for admins, especially
> when looking at eprint records.
>
> Find the item via a normal route (summary page -> View item) or Admin
> item search.
>
> "Manage records" is a generic swiss-army knife, that won't show you any
> special actions. The two views on records (/items) will eventually
> merge, as the eprints internals get sorted out.
